ZAP Hedge Fund Activity: Q3 2025 in Review
29 of the 7,621 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Global X U.S. Electrification ETF (ZAP) for Q3 2025, worth a combined $74M — up 1,516% from $4.58M a quarter earlier.
Buyers outnumbered sellers: 18 funds opened new ZAP positions and 1 closed out — a net gain of 17 holders — while 9 added to existing stakes and 0 trimmed.
The largest buyer was Bensler, opening a new position worth an estimated $27.2M. The largest seller was AmeriFlex Group, exiting entirely with an estimated $4.98K sold.
